Leavell (English, Oklahoma State U.) examines the role the visual arts played in the development of Moore’s poetry. B&w photos and examples of modernist art show the poet’s work in its interdisciplinary context as the author traces the formation of Moore’s modernism from her exposure to arts and crafts ideology in adolescence to her position as editor of the Dial in the late 1920s, where she became America’s foremost arbiter of modernist taste.
